Here's an ideal itinerary for 3 days in Los Angeles that is family-friendly and includes parks and green spaces:

Day 1:

  • Start your day with a visit to the Griffith Observatory, which offers stunning views of the city and has interactive exhibits about space and science.
  • Afterward, head to the nearby Griffith Park, one of the largest urban parks in the country. You can hike one of the many trails, have a picnic, or visit the Los Angeles Zoo, which is located within the park.
  • In the afternoon, head to Santa Monica Pier, where you can ride the Ferris wheel, play arcade games, and enjoy the beach. The pier also has several restaurants and shops.

Day 2:

  • Begin your day at the Getty Center, a museum with beautiful gardens and art collections from around the world. The Getty Center also offers free admission, so it's a great option for families on a budget.
  • Afterward, head to Runyon Canyon Park, a popular hiking spot with stunning views of the city. The park also has several dog-friendly trails if you're traveling with pets.
  • In the evening, head to Universal Studios Hollywood, where you can experience movie-themed rides and attractions.

Day 3:

  • Start your day at the Los Angeles County Museum of Art (LACMA), which has a large collection of art from around the world. The museum also has several outdoor installations and sculptures.
  • Afterward, head to the nearby La Brea Tar Pits, where you can see fossils of prehistoric animals that were trapped in the tar pits thousands of years ago.
  • In the afternoon, head to Venice Beach, where you can stroll along the boardwalk, watch street performers, and enjoy the beach. The area also has several restaurants and shops.

Places of interest

Griffith Observatory Los Angeles

Griffith Observatory

Griffith Observatory is a popular tourist attraction located in Los Angeles, California. It offers stunning views of the city and houses various exhibits related to astronomy and space exploration.

Griffith Park Los Angeles

Griffith Park

Griffith Park is a large urban park located in the eastern Santa Monica Mountains of Los Angeles, California. It covers an area of 4,310 acres and offers a variety of recreational activities such as hiking, biking, horseback riding, golfing, and more.

Los Angeles Zoo Los Angeles

Los Angeles Zoo

The Los Angeles Zoo is a popular attraction located in Griffith Park, featuring over 1,400 animals from around the world in naturalistic habitats.

Santa Monica Pier Los Angeles

Santa Monica Pier

Santa Monica Pier is a historic landmark and popular tourist destination located in Los Angeles, California. It features an amusement park, aquarium, restaurants, shops, and beautiful views of the Pacific Ocean.

Getty Center Los Angeles

Getty Center

The Getty Center is a museum and research center located in Los Angeles, California. It features a collection of European paintings, drawings, sculptures, and decorative arts, as well as American and international photography.
